Whereas, Central Verification Committee of the Bar Council of Indiain its Fourth Meeting held on 12-11-2017 at New Delhi has resolved asunder :––

“It is also stated therein that almost every State, quite large numberof advocates, particularly seniors did not submit their verificationforms for issuance of certificate of practice and the State BarCouncil are not receiving applications after the date stipulated bythe Hon’ble Supreme Court of India. After discussing the matterat some length, they are of the view that the date stipulated by theHon’ble Supreme Court of India is only with reference topreparation of voters list for the respective State Bar Councils andthere is no prohibition as such for receiving verification formssubsequent to the said date for the simple purpose of obtainingcertificate of practice and identity cards. The advocates who submitthe verification forms beyond the stipulated date may not be ableto vote in the election to the Bar Council unless of course, theHon’ble Supreme Court of India permits them”.

“15. Exemption for Advocates enrolled before 1-1-1976 :–

The Bar Council of India, however, keeping in view thedifficulties of old advocates who are in practice for 40 yearsor more [i. e. those enrolled prior to 1-1-1976] waives thiscondition and exempts the production of certificatesalong with the verification form. However, they will also berequired to submit the copy of their enrolment certificatealong with their verification forms.

But all those Advocates who have obtained their law degreeson or after 1st January, 1976 shall have to produce therequired certificates i. e. Matriculation, Graduation/LL.B.

Page 16: THE JAMMU & KASHMIR GOVERNMENT GAZETTE 2014/2018/Gazette No.18...2018/08/02  · Ms. Danish Akhter D/o Gh. Mohammad Sheikh R/o Chatrasoo Budroo, Pather Pora, Tehsil Pahalgam, District

226 The J&K Govt. Gazette, 2nd Aug., 2018/11th Srav., 1940. [ No. 18––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––—–––———–

There can be no compromise so far the production ofenrolment certificates from the concerned State BarCouncils is concerned even for those who were enrolled priorto 1-1-1976”.

Schedule

(1) Salt and hydroscopic substances

(2) Raw (wet and salted) hides and skins

(3) Newspapers and periodicals

(4) Menthol, Camphor, Saffron

(5) Refills for ball-point pens

(6) Lighter fuel, including lighters with gas, not having arrangementfor refilling

(7) Cells, batteries and rechargeable batteries

(8) Petroleum Products

(9) Dangerous drugs and psychotropic substances

(10) Bulk drugs and chemicals falling under Section VI of the FirstSchedule to the Customs Tariff Act, 1975 (51 of 1975)

(11) Pharmaceutical products falling within Chapter 30 of the FirstSchedule to the Customs Tariff Act, 1975 (51 of 1975)

(12) Fireworks

(13) Red Sander

(14) Sandalwood

(15) All taxable goods falling within Chapters 1 to 24 of the First

Schedule to the Customs Tariff Act, 1975 (51 of 1975)

Page 67: THE JAMMU & KASHMIR GOVERNMENT GAZETTE 2014/2018/Gazette No.18...2018/08/02  · Ms. Danish Akhter D/o Gh. Mohammad Sheikh R/o Chatrasoo Budroo, Pather Pora, Tehsil Pahalgam, District

No. 11-d] The J&K Govt. Gazette,14th June, 2018/24th Jyai., 1940.3–––––––—––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––———

(16) All unclaimed/abandoned goods which are liable to rapid

depreciation in value on account of fast change in technology or

new models etc.

(17) Any goods seized by the proper officer under section 67 of

the said Act, which are to be provisionally released under

sub-section (6) of section 67 of the said Act, but provisional

release has not been taken by the concerned person within a

period of one month from the date of execution of the bond for

provisional release.

The notification shall come into force with effect from 13th day of

June, 2018.

THE INSOLVENCY A ND BANKRUPTCY CODE(AMENDMENT) ORDINANCE, 2018

No. 6 of 2018

Promulgated by the President in the Sixty-ninth Year of the Republicof India.

An Ordinance further to amend the Insolvency and BankruptcyCode, 2016.

Page 88: THE JAMMU & KASHMIR GOVERNMENT GAZETTE 2014/2018/Gazette No.18...2018/08/02  · Ms. Danish Akhter D/o Gh. Mohammad Sheikh R/o Chatrasoo Budroo, Pather Pora, Tehsil Pahalgam, District

2 The J&K Govt. Gazette, 10th July, 2018/19th Asad., 1940. [No. 14-3––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––––

Whereas, the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code, 2016 (the Code),inter alia, provides for insolvency resolution of corporate persons in a timebound manner for maximisation of value of assets of such persons ;

And whereas, a need has been felt, inter alia, to balance the interestsof various stakeholders in the Code, especially interests of home buyers andmicro, small and medium enterprises, promoting resolution over liquidationof corporate debtor by lowering the voting threshold of committee of creditorsand streamlining provisions relating to eligibility of resolution applicants ;

And whereas, Parliament is not in session and the President is satisfiedthat circumstances exist which render it necessary for him to take immediateaction.

Now, therefore, in exercise of the powers conferred by clause (1) ofArticle 123 of the Constitution, the President is pleased to promulgate thefollowing Ordinance :––

1. Short title and commencement.––(1) This Ordinance may be calledthe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code (Amendment) Ordinance, 2018.

(2) It shall come into force at once.

2. Amendment of section 3.––In the Insolvency and BankruptcyCode, 2016 (31 of 2016) (hereinafter referred to as the principal Act), insection 3, in clause (12), for the word “repaid”, the word “paid” shall besubstituted.
